Ceramic Super Intalox Ring – Easy flowing & Distributing

Ceramic Super intalox saddle ring is improved from the ceramic intalox saddle ring. It changes the both arched surface with gear. This design can increase voidage between random packing, which is benefit for the flowing and distributing of liquid and gas.

Features & Benefits

  • Low pressure drop.
  • High mass transfer.
  • Large packing voidage.
  • Benefit for even distribution of liquid and gas.
  • Excellent acid and alkali resistance performance.

Applications

  • It is widely used in the drying columns and absorption columns in sulfuric acid production.
  • Because of the excellent resistance to various inorganic acid, organic acids and organic solvents except for hydrofluoric acid, they are widely used in various acid corrosive productions.
  • High temperature resistance make it be widely used in high temperature conditions.
Chemical Properties of Ceramic Super Intalox Ring
SiO2 + Al2O3 > 92% CaO < 1.0%
SiO2 > 76% MgO < 0.5%
Al2O3 > 17% K2O + Na2O < 3.5%
Fe2O3 < 1.0% Other < 1%
Physical Properties of Ceramic Super Intalox Ring
Water absorption < 0.5% Moh’s hardness > 6.5 scale
Porosity < 1% Acid resistance > 99.6%
Specific gravity 2.3 – 2.40 g/cm3 Alkali resistance > 85%
Max operation temperature 950-1100 °C
